Output 30bdb90d45a206ac0f397d55e66faee6fcbceed40d2d66f64688bb63e88717c3:12

value
306154
script pubkey
OP_0 OP_PUSHBYTES_20 6de436b70c8923ad823e0516e89f1d6128b81fa4
address
bc1qdhjrddcv3y36mq37q5tw38cavy5ts8ayc8a98y
transaction
30bdb90d45a206ac0f397d55e66faee6fcbceed40d2d66f64688bb63e88717c3
confirmations
168234
spent
true